Job description

We are sharing a specialised part-time consulting opportunity for experienced FP&A and corporate finance professionals with strong expertise in financial planning and analysis, budgeting, forecasting, management reporting, financial modelling, and business performance analysis.

This role focuses on reviewing professional documents, spreadsheets, and presentation materials related to FP&A and corporate finance. Selected experts will assess outputs for financial accuracy, analytical rigour, modelling quality, commercial relevance, presentation effectiveness, and overall professional credibility.
